Job Description

We seek exceptional candidate for Training Coordinator role who’s primary focus will be to coordinate, plan and support implementation of the training activities and other tasks assigned to him/her by the project manager based on the projects’ scope of work. The assignments of project coordinators will vary over time, in line with changes and demands of the projects/programs.

Role + Responsibilities

This role will mainly support the program management team including the project/program managers, program director and the rest of the team on day-to-day business of the project. Being responsible for one or several components of a project at a time, the coordinator plays a key role, and works closely with the project management team.

The Training Coordinator’s key duties will be to:

  • Help the management team with the planning and implementation of the journalists’ capacity building program under the Lapis portfolio
  • Coordinate with the Project manager and training consultants to prepare comprehensive implementation plan for the training activities 
  • Coordinate with the training consultants and project manager to organize the training activities based on the approved comprehensive implementation plan.
  • Coordinate with the Admin and Finance officer and project manager to ensure appropriate trainings venues are booked and all training related logistical issues are efficiently and effectively taken care of. In coordination with the project manager and Admin and Finance officer, facilitate travel and accommodation arrangements of the training participants.
  • Work closely with the training consultant to prepare training evaluation and feedback forms.
  • Distribute and collect training evaluation and feedback forms at the end of each training course.
  • Analyse the evaluation and feedback forms and forward your recommendations to the training consultants to consider possible adjustments in the future trainings.
  • Ensure that post-training reports are produced, shared with project manager and program manager.
  • Develop robust, well-designed reports and briefing notes with the highest quality 
  • Take part in all aspects of program delivery with a focus on the integration of core Lapis verticals; research, strategy and planning, creative, production, media and M&E
  • Help with the tasks related to budgeting, cash flows and compliance
  • Ensure relevant quality assurance processes are completed so that programs are running effectively and on time
  • Help with monitoring of risks and issues developments within the portfolio sub-set

Job Requirements

  • Bachelor Degree in journalism, economics, business or related fields. Master’s degree will be preferred. 
  • 4-5 years of relevant experience
  • Commitment to and passion for positive change
  • Extensive experience in project coordination
  • Presentation abilities and excellent written/oral communications
  • Understanding of the social and media landscape
  • Ability to engage with clients and establish, deepen, and grow relationships with colleagues from different organisations, functions, and cultures
  • Ability to identify and implement effective processes for achieving outcomes
  • A high degree of flexibility and adaptability to respond to changing needs and effectively address issue
  • Attention for detail and ability to effectively manage a high volume of data and information
